M E M O R A N D U M O P I N I O N
This is an appeal from a judgment signed April 23, 2004.
On January 28, 2005, appellant filed a motion to dismiss the appeal because the case has been settled. See Tex. R. App. P. 42.1. The motion is granted.
Accordingly, the appeal is ordered dismissed.
